How do you calculate bills based on income?
Income-Based Say Person A makes 60% of the total household income. Under this system, Person A will then pay 60% of the household bills. How do you calculate the percentage of household income? Add up the incomes of both individuals and then divide the largest income by that number.
How do I figure out my monthly income?
Calculating gross monthly income if you're paid hourly First, to find your yearly pay, multiply your hourly wage by the number of hours you work each week, and then multiply the total by 52. Now that you know your annual gross income, divide it by 12 to find the monthly amount.
How do you figure out a percentage of 2 income?
Use the following formula to calculate a percentage: number divided by total income times 100 equals the percentage. For example, if the number in question is $100, and your total income is $1,500, divide 100 by 1,500, and multiply the result by 100 to get the percentage.
How much of your income should go to bills?
The 50-30-20 rule puts 50 percent of your income toward necessities, like housing and bills. Twenty percent should then go toward financial goals, like paying off debt or saving for retirement. Finally, thirty percent of your income can be allocated to wants, like dining or entertainment.

What is the 50 20 30 budget rule?
What is the 50/20/30 budget rule? Senator Elizabeth Warren popularized the 50/20/30 budget rule in her book All Your Worth: The Ultimate Lifetime Money Plan. The basic rule is to divide after-tax income, spending 50% on needs and 30% on wants while allocating 20% to savings.
